1. Why Legacy File Transfer Systems Fall Short
Traditional file movement methods frequently fail when confronted with massive datasets, regulatory compliance mandates, and heterogeneous network environments. Implementing a unified framework for data management allows companies to retain complete visibility, establish governance, and safeguard sensitive digital assets throughout their lifecycle.
Organizations face several recurring obstacles when attempting to modernize their data pipelines:
- Network Congestion: Transferring petabyte-scale datasets across geographic locations often results in high latency and packet loss.
- Data Protection Risks: Lack of audit trails makes compliance verification extremely difficult during security audits.
- Capital Expenditure Strain: Scaling hardware to handle peak bandwidth demands leads to underutilized server assets during off-peak hours.

3. Accelerating Seamless Data Migration Across Cloud and On-Premises Systems
System upgrades and cloud adoption require transferring vast stores of structured and unstructured information without downtime. Utilizing specialized platforms for data migration minimizes operational downtime, preserves metadata integrity, and ensures business continuity throughout the transition process.
Executing a seamless system migration requires careful planning across key stages:
- Pre-Migration Assessment: Defining bandwidth allocation strategies to avoid network degradation.
- High-Throughput Ingestion: Leveraging parallel processing streams to maximize transfer rates across distributed networks.
- Integrity Verification: Performing automated checksum comparisons to verify exact file consistency between source and target.
